The Rt Hon Sir Menzies Campbell, CBE, QC, MP's Professional Career

Career
admitted advocate 1968, advocate depute 1977-80, standing jr counsel to the Army in Scotland 1980-82; pt/t chm: VAT Tbnl 1984-87, Med Appeal Tbnl 1985-87; memb: Legal Aid Central Ctee 1983-86, Broadcasting Cncl for Scotland 1984-87, Scottish Legal Aid Bd 1986-87; Parly candidate (Lib): Greenock and Port Glasgow 1974 (both Gen Elections), E Fife 1979, NE Fife 1983; MP (Lib 1987-88, Lib Dem 1988-) Fife NE 1987-; Lib then Lib Dem spokesman on sport 1987-; Lib Dem spokesman on: defence 1988-95, foreign affairs and defence 1995-, foreign affairs, defence and Europe 1997-; Lib Dem shadow foreign sec 1997-2006, ldr Lib Dems 2006-07 (dep ldr 2003-06); memb House of Commons: Trade and Industry Select Ctee 1990-92, Defence Select Ctee 1992-99, Foreign Affrs Ctee 2007-, Intelligence and Security Ctee 2007-; ldr UK Delgn to the NATO Parly Assembly; capt UK athletics team 1965 and 1966, competed in Olympic Games Tokyo 1964 and Cwlth Games 1966, UK 100 metres record holder 1967-74; memb 2012 Olympic Bd
